History | | |
Memorial Day, an American holiday observed on the last Monday of May, honors men and women who died while serving in the U.S. military. Originally known as Decoration Day, it originated in the years following the Civil War and became an official federal holiday in 1971. Many Americans observe Memorial Day by visiting cemeteries or memorials, holding family gatherings and participating in parades. Unofficially, at least, it marks the beginning of summer.

Quotes to Remember
"Let every nation know, whether it wishes us well or ill, that we shall pay any price, bear any burden, meet any hardship, support any friend, oppose any foe to assure the survival and the success of liberty." -John F. Kennedy
"I only regret that I have but one life to give for my country" - Nathan Hale
"Guard against the impostures of pretended patriotism." - George Washington
"For love of country they accepted death"- James A. Garfield
"A hero is someone who has given his or her life to something bigger than oneself." - Joseph Campbell
"Ah! never shall the land forget, how gushed the life-blood of her brave"- William Cullen Bryant
"We come, not to mourn our dead soldiers, but to praise them." - Francis A. Walker
"How important it is for us to recognize and celebrate our heroes and she-roes! " - Maya Angelou
"The brave die never, though they sleep in dust, their courage nerves a thousand living men." -Minot J. Savage
"The dead soldier's silence sings our national anthem." -Aaron Kilbourn
